Default Re: 1965 Chevelle 12 Bolt Question

I have sold two of the Z16 rears in the past.
A bare housing went for $2200 and a complate rear went for $3500.

The BE rears used a special heat treated r&p set and a 4-series posi unit with special internals.
There was one made for every COPO car. I believe the rears
were one of the hold ups on the assembly of some of the COPO cars.

There are two "BE" coded rears on Ebay right now.
One is a restamp.
Last month a fake BE sold for $3173.21.

There is only one way to find out what you can get for it, and that is to list it.

And on the "KQ" Chavelle rears, I have been getting outbid on the real ones at $9K+.
